Farris's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Farris splits its recorded history at 1963: 34% of all births land in the more recent half, 66% in the earlier half, leaning more toward its earlier era than today's. The single quietest year was 1897 (5 births) -- compare that against the 1923 peak of 56 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Farris?
Farris has been given to 2,991 babies in the U.S. since 1897, according to SSA data. Its archive ordinal is #2,543 of 45,481 among boys' names (total births, highest first). Among boys in 2025, it is #7,208 of 13,930. 56 babies were born in 1923, its single highest year.
Where does Farris sit in the SSA name archive?
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Farris ranks #2,543 of 45,481 boys' names by all-time recorded births (highest first) and #7,208 of 13,930 among boys' names in 2025. All-time ordinal matches browse popularity (total births DESC); the current ordinal uses the 2025 SSA file. See /methodology#corpus-placement.
When was Farris most popular?
Farris was most popular in the 1920s decade with 457 total births. The single peak year was 1923.
Where is Farris most popular?
The top states for the name Farris are Georgia (238 births), Tennessee (151 births), Texas (128 births).
Is Farris a unisex name?
Yes, Farris is used for both boys and girls. As a boy's name it has 2,991 births, and as a girl's name it has 547 births.
How long has the name Farris been used?
Farris has been recorded in Social Security data since 1897, spanning 129 years of data through 2025.
